Tree Root Pipe Damage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Water damage is minor and contained. Yes No DIY cleaning and drying can be effective for small areas.
Water damage is extensive or in multiple areas. No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are needed to handle large-scale water damage.
There's visible mold or bacterial growth. No Yes Professionals have the necessary equipment and training to safely remove mold and bacteria.
You're unsure about the cause of the water damage. No Yes Professionals can investigate the source of the damage and provide a detailed estimate for repairs.
Water damage has contaminated personal belongings. No Yes Professionals can safely clean and restore damaged items.
You're not comfortable with DIY water damage cleanup. No Yes Professionals will handle the cleanup and restoration process, ensuring your safety and peace of mind.

With tree root pipe damage water removal, professional help matters most in situations where water damage is extensive, there's visible mold or bacterial growth, or you're unsure about the cause of the damage. Don't risk it. Call a professional.

Common Questions About Tree Root Pipe Damage Water Removal

Q: How long will it take to dry my home?

Depending on the extent of the damage, drying can take anywhere from 3-5 days. Our team will provide a detailed timeline and regular updates.

Q: Will my home need to be completely torn out?

Not always. In some cases, we may be able to save and restore your home's original parts. Our team will assess the damage and provide recommendations.

Q: Can I use bleach to clean my home?

No, bleach is not recommended for cleaning water-damaged homes. Our team uses specialized equipment and cleaning solutions to ensure your home is safe and healthy.
